Tata Elxsi Collaborates with Arm to Accelerate the Software-Defined Vehicle Journey for OEMs

Retrieved on: 
Martedì, Maggio 7, 2024

Automotive architectures are evolving from a distributed and domain-based paradigm to SDV, which includes the use of high-performance computing (HPC).

Key Points: 
  • Automotive architectures are evolving from a distributed and domain-based paradigm to SDV, which includes the use of high-performance computing (HPC).
  • Tata Elxsi brings its extensive portfolio of SDV solutions through Tata Elxsi AVENIR, a SOAFEE-based software suite that enables the development, integration, building, testing, and deployment of applications entirely on the cloud with ease for OEMs and suppliers.
  • "By bringing together its SDV solutions with Arm's latest AE technology, Tata Elxsi is leveraging Arm's efficient performance and safety leadership to accelerate software development cycles for next-generation vehicles."
  • This integration accelerates the "shift-left" in SDV development and validation processes, helping drastically cut down time-to-market and development risks.

Untether AI Announces Collaboration with Arm To Deliver High Performance, Energy-Efficient Solutions

Retrieved on: 
Martedì, Aprile 16, 2024

Untether AI , the leader in energy-centric AI inference acceleration, today announced a collaboration with Arm to develop best-in-class solutions optimized for next-generation automotive applications.

Key Points: 
  • Untether AI , the leader in energy-centric AI inference acceleration, today announced a collaboration with Arm to develop best-in-class solutions optimized for next-generation automotive applications.
  • As part of this collaboration, Untether AI will enable its inference acceleration technology to be implemented alongside the latest-generation Automotive Enhanced (AE) technology from Arm, to create solutions that address performance, power, safety, and security requirements for advanced Driver Assistance Systems (ADAS) and autonomous vehicle (AV) applications.
  • Through close collaboration with leading OEMs, automotive suppliers, and membership in the SOAFEE consortium, Untether AI has developed an in-depth understanding of the unique requirements associated with emerging SDV architectures.

Tier One Auto Suppliers Must Evolve with the Supply Chain to Access the 2030 US$15 Billion Next-Gen Cockpit Domain Controller Market

Retrieved on: 
Martedì, Aprile 23, 2024

NEW YORK, April 23, 2024 /PRNewswire/ -- The traditional tiered supply chain system is no longer relevant to the automotive industry, especially for the digital cockpit.

Key Points: 
  • NEW YORK, April 23, 2024 /PRNewswire/ -- The traditional tiered supply chain system is no longer relevant to the automotive industry, especially for the digital cockpit.
  • Tier One suppliers have been evolving in their specialties and responsibilities accordingly.
  • One of these roles is supplying component agnostic, mixed-criticality enabled, future-proofed digital Cockpit Domain Controllers (CDCs), which ABI Research, a global technology intelligence firm, forecasts to reach a market size of US$15 billion by 2030, growing at a CAGR of 34%.
  • Tier One's adjustments to the evolution of the automotive ecosystem, and within that, the digital cockpit ecosystem, doesn't only require strategic investment and R&D into new technologies.
